Music by Shuki Levy.Austin St. John, Thuy Trang, Walter Jones, Amy Jo Johnson, Richard Steven Horvitz, David Yost.On an exploratory mission, two astronauts discover an extraterrestrial container (referred to as a dumpster as a result of its smell) and breach the unit, inadvertently releasing the evil alien sorceress Rita Repulsa from 10,000 years of confinement. Upon her release, she and her army of evil space aliens set their sights on conquering the nearest planet: Earth. The wise sage Zordon, who was responsible for capturing Rita Repulsa, becomes aware of her release and orders his robotic assistant Alpha 5 to select five "teenagers with attitude" to defend the Earth from Rita's attacks. The five teens chosen are Jason Lee Scott, Kimberly Hart, Zack Taylor, Trini Kwan, and Billy Cranston. Zordon gives them the ability to transform into a fighting force known as the Power Rangers, providing them with an arsenal of weapons at their disposal, as well as colossal assault machines called Zords, which can combine into the Megazord.Rating: TV-Y7 for fantasy violence.DVD, NTSC, region 1.

Music by Shuky Levy, Kussa Mahchi.Austin St. John, Thuy Trang, Walter Jones, Amy Jo Johnson, Richard Steven Horvitz, David Yost, Jason Frank.Rita Repulsa has failed to dominate Earth for the last time; and now her boss, Lord Zedd, is stepping in to finish the Power Rangers once and for all. Zedd uses the arsenal of monsters that he created from Earthly plants and animals to try and accomplish his goal. Faced with an enemy twice as evil as Rita Repulsa, the Power Rangers will need greater powers. So, they are equipped with new Zords modeled after mythological creatures and are joined by the mighty White Ranger.Rating: TV-Y7.DVD, region 1, NTSC.
